Laimgrubengasse 10, 1060 Wien, Österreich - GW Instek, the innovation leader in the measurement industry, proudly celebrates its 50th anniversary. Founded in 1975, the company revolutionized the world of electrical test and measuring instruments with its commitment to "Integrity, Quality and Innovation". technological achievements

In 2024, GW Instek presented a number of groundbreaking solutions, including the ASR-6000, a high-performance AC/DC power supply that is equipped with silicon carbide technology (SIC) and offers an impressive performance of up to 24 kva. This makes it an ideal power source for applications such as AI servers and electric vehicles. In addition, the modular data acquisition system DAQ-9600 was introduced, which offers the highest flexibility for various test requirements, as well as the MPO-20000 oscilloscope, which enables users to program with Python and thus offer tailor-made test solutions. For the year 2025, GW Instek plans the introduction of the new phu high-performance equal power power supply device, which will offer a variety of powerful options. It is designed for versatile applications, including the electric vehicle and semiconductor industry.
